A seasonal unit study works like any unit study, one theme pulling every subject through it, except the theme is locked to the calendar: fall, a specific holiday, the first snow, the start of spring. That calendar anchor is what makes it work, the timing does half the motivational work a themed unit needs, since a family already feels the season without you having to manufacture interest in it.

A seasonal unit study works like any homeschool unit study, one theme pulling every subject through it, but anchored to the calendar instead of a chosen topic. Fall, a specific holiday, the first snow. That anchor does real work: a family already feels the season, so the unit doesn't have to manufacture interest the way a random topic sometimes does. It also means the activities have to be genuinely tied to the season, not a worksheet with seasonal clip art standing in for a real connection.
